The Opportunity: MRI Clinical Program Manager
We are seeking a dynamic and experienced Imaging Clinical Program Manager to take the lead in planning, directing, managing, and coordinating all aspects of our enterprise-wide MRI Safety and Implant Safety Program.
This role requires a dedicated professional who can interact with all imaging sections to provide leadership, operational support, policies, procedures, and technical guidance. You will collaborate across the enterprise to ensure seamless program implementation, staff training, proper use of program resources, and compliance with all state, federal, and regulatory bodies.
Reporting to an Associate Director or Executive Director, this position is crucial to maintaining the highest standards of patient safety and quality in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I).
Summary of Essential Duties and Responsibilities
Program Management & Compliance: Oversee and manage the assigned imaging program, holding authority for day-to-day operations and administration.
Safety Protocol Supervision: In partnership with Imaging Physics, supervise all MR protocol changes and enhancements to guarantee strict compliance with all MRI safety requirements mandated by state, federal, and accreditation agencies within the health system's imaging operations.
Implant Safety Expertise: Serve as the key resource for research, protocols, and safety guidelines for all MRI patients with implants and implanted devices.
Training & Competency: Develop and deliver initial training, and continuously monitor ongoing competency, for all Magnetic Resonance Imaging Technologists (MR Techs) performing scans across the health system.
Documentation & Accreditation: Develop and maintain comprehensive MR Tech training records. Manage and ensure the accreditation of all MR scanners within the system.
Leadership: May supervise staff (either indirectly or directly) with regard to service excellence and human capital development.

Quality Program Manager
Atlanta, GA jobs
The first 3 letters in workplace safety are Y-O-U! TK Elevator is currently seeking a Quality Program Manager located in Atlanta, GA. Responsible for assimilating into the field organization to deliver consistent processes into field operations leveraging current field best practices, processes recommended by the design team, and harmonizing the production activities to align with the field needs and practices.
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
* Lead and coordinate remediation of field product. Partner with engineering, manufacturing, and field functions along with suppliers to drive timely execution of Service Bulletin and PCI (Product Corrective Instruction).
* Leveraging data from across the organization identify best practices currently in place in the field for key tasks, including but not limited to installation and modernization.
* Implement best practices identified to initially pilot branches and eventually to all North America branches
* Use available data systems to ensure that the identified standard of work is consistently executed
* Partnering with engineering identify corrections to be completed on fielded units, coordinate with manufacturing operations to compile an effected units list, and coordinate with procurement to verify that any necessary materials are available for the field to complete the correction.
* Partner with the field organization to complete identified field corrections in a timely and systemic manner
* Leveraging available data systems monitor the execution of the field corrections and report to the business leadership team during standard operating mechanisms
* Partner with Quality team members to provide ad hoc and scheduled training for field personnel on the quality processes including but not limited to defect reporting.
* Using lessons learned and available data drive process improvement with the field organization to resolve identified systemic issues.
